SpaceX’s Spectrum Surveillance Ups Ante in FCC Fight

Summary by Payload
SpaceX called out rival Echostar for allegedly failing to meet deployment requirements for radio spectrum in the 2 GHz band, using novel evidence: A spectrum analysis performed by a Starlink satellite.  The FCC assigned a portion of the spectrum known as AWS-4 to Echostar, a subsidiary of Charlie Ergen’s Dish Networks, to support both satellite communications and a ground-based 5G network.  Checking your work: SpaceX told the FCC on April 14 tha…
